Summary:
Develops, implements and supervises all procedures, activities, and personnel for the safe handling, storage, and preparation of compounded products, including regulatory compliance and quality assurance.

Detailed responsibilities:
• Manages the daily compounding operations (sterile and non-sterile, hazardous and non hazardous) and assists in meeting pharmacy compliance with compounding requirements as regulated by the board of pharmacy, USP and Federal regulations, including all regulatory, accreditation, and certification requirements.
• Maintains up to date knowledge on regulatory requirements and practical applications to address gaps in the compounding operations.
• Manages, maintains, and troubleshoots technology and automation resources to assure appropriateness of preparation, distribution, administration, and monitoring outcomes for drugs as related to pharmaceutical compounding.
• Provides oversight of compounding policies and procedures development, implementation, maintenance and adherence.
• Responsible for the training, education, and competencies of pharmacy and supportive personnel including performance monitoring and corrective actions related to compounding and its related activities.
• Assures environmental controls (primary and secondary) of all compounding areas and continuous quality assurance testing and monitoring of all compounded products. Has quality oversight of outsourced compounded facilities and preparations.
• Identifies and implements recommendations for process improvement including cost effectiveness, operational efficiency, and inventory management as related to compounding areas.
• Performs and cross-functions in all clinical pharmacist roles and functions as needed.

Organizational Profile:
Memorial Hospital West opened in 1992 with 100 beds to serve the growing population of western Broward. Today, the hospital has 384 beds and is one of the busiest and most technologically advanced in the region.
